4-(3,4-Di­methyl­phenyl)-3,5-di-2-pyridy
✍ Shao, Si-Chang ;Liu, Hui-Jun ;Zhang, Shu-Ping ;Yang, Song ;Hao, Fu-Ying ;Li, Che 📂 Article 📅 2004 🏛 International Union of Crystallography 🌐 English ⚖ 336 KB

The title compound, C 21 H 19 N 5 , has been synthesized and characterized by single-crystal X-ray diffraction. The dihedral angle between the benzene and triazole rings is 123.0 (5) . The triazole ring forms dihedral angles of 36.5 (5) and 50.1 (5) with the two pyridyl rings.

4-Amino-3,5-bis(4-pyridyl)-1,2,4-triazol
✍ Guo, Ya-Mei ;Du, Miao 📂 Article 📅 2002 🏛 International Union of Crystallography 🌐 English ⚖ 280 KB

The two pyridine rings in the title compound, C 12 H 10 N 6 , form dihedral angles of 35.7 (2) and 16.8 (2) with the central triazole ring. The molecules exist as centrosymmetrically related dimers and form a three-dimensional network through intermolecular NÐHÁ Á ÁN hydrogen bonds.
